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/url/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Postgresql 使用bucardo在目标中插入源数据_Postgresql_Postgresql 9.6_Bucardo - Fatal编程技术网

Postgresql 使用bucardo在目标中插入源数据

Postgresql 使用bucardo在目标中插入源数据,postgresql,postgresql-9.6,bucardo,Postgresql,Postgresql 9.6,Bucardo,我想使用bucardo在两个数据库之间创建同步。这是单向同步。目标和源不相同(架构相同,但数据不同) 我已将安装程序与属性onetimecopy=2同步,但日志显示 has rows and we are in onetimecopy if empty mode, so we will not COPY 我不想删除目标上的数据,只想将目标上不可用的数据从源复制到目标。有点过时,但只有当目标不为空时,onetimecopy=2才起作用 将其设置为1,从源到目标进行复制,不受此限制,但要注意与主键

我想使用bucardo在两个数据库之间创建同步。这是单向同步。目标和源不相同(架构相同,但数据不同)

我已将安装程序与属性onetimecopy=2同步,但日志显示

has rows and we are in onetimecopy if empty mode, so we will not COPY
我不想删除目标上的数据,只想将目标上不可用的数据从源复制到目标。

有点过时,但只有当目标不为空时,
onetimecopy=2
才起作用

将其设置为
1
,从源到目标进行
复制,不受此限制,但要注意与主键的冲突

对于数据的初始加载,我通常不依赖Bucardo,而是在pg_dump或其他更容易理解的过程中进行加载。

有点过时,但是
onetimecopy=2
仅在目标不为空时才起作用

将其设置为
1
,从源到目标进行
复制,不受此限制,但要注意与主键的冲突

对于数据的初始加载,我通常不依赖Bucardo,而是在pg_dump或其他任何地方,因为我似乎更容易理解这个过程